VA Awards $241.8M Task Order to QTC Medical Services for Physician Services in FY25

Contract Overview

Contract Amount: $241,754,900 ($241.8M)

Contractor: QTC Medical Services Inc

Awarding Agency: Department of Veterans Affairs

Start Date: 2024-10-01

End Date: 2025-09-30

Contract Duration: 364 days

Daily Burn Rate: $664.2K/day

Competition Type: FULL AND OPEN COMPETITION

Number of Offers Received: 1

Pricing Type: FIRM FIXED PRICE

Sector: Healthcare

Official Description: MDE FY25 FUNDING TASK ORDER - SUBJECT TO THE AVAILABILITY OF FUNDS.
